First line support normally involves dealing with customers, clients or employees directly to resolve their issues. Normally the issues are fairly basic. Second line support should take over a support request once it has been established there is a problem with the supported 'system' and it is not to do with user training, user environment, etc. Second line support will liaise with third line support for any highly technical issues. Second line support is usually the middle-man between first line and third line Third line support is a non-customer focused base of technical staff that will investigate and resolve problems.

A double bar-line indicates the end of a section. When the second line is thicker than the first, it indicates the end of the piece.

The shape is known as an involute the shape is analogous to unwinding a piece of string from a spool representing the base circle diameter of the gear, imagine your pencil at the end of the string and the string kept tight during unwinding, unwind until line meets OD of gear, then apply blend radius at base circle, then mirror about tooth centre line for full tooth profile.
